MHSanaei fa1a19c03c style: adopt golangci-lint v2 and resolve all findings
Add .golangci.yml (v2): the standard linters plus bodyclose, errorlint, noctx, misspell, rowserrcheck, sqlclosecheck, unconvert, usestdlibvars, with gofumpt + goimports formatters. Enable the std-error-handling exclusion preset for idiomatic Close/Remove/Setenv ignores; scope-exclude SA1019 (parser.ParseDir in tools/openapigen) and ST1005 (intentional capitalized user-facing error copy that tests assert verbatim). No inline nolint directives were introduced.

Resolve all 217 findings behavior-preserving: gofumpt/goimports formatting, explicit blank assignment on intentionally ignored errors, errors.Is/errors.As and %w wrapping, context-aware stdlib calls (CommandContext/QueryContext/NewRequestWithContext/Dialer), staticcheck simplifications, removed redundant conversions, http.StatusOK and http.MethodGet, inlined the go:fix intPtr helper, and deferred sql rows Close. Add a golangci CI job mirroring the existing Go jobs.

MHSanaei 896016f7f6 fix(web): remove deleted multi-inbound client from runtime regardless of shared email (#5543)
DelInboundClientByEmail gated the runtime RemoveUser/DeleteUser (and its
push-plan resolution) on !emailShared. But Xray users are keyed by inbound
tag + email, so a client attached to two inbounds left its user live in the
running Xray of every inbound where the email was still shared by a sibling
inbound, until an Xray restart.

Decouple the per-inbound runtime removal from emailShared; keep emailShared
only for preserving the shared email-keyed client_traffics/IP rows.
